Extraction protocol |
The DNA extraction was performed following the manufacturer instructions using the Quick-DNA Plant/Seed Miniprep Kit from Zymoresearch. For each sample the DNA concentration and quality was measured using a Qubit fluorometer. Ultralow Methyl-Seq System (Tecan/NuGEN, Redwood City, CA) has been used for library preparation following the manufacturer’s instructions. DNA samples were quantified with Qubit 2.0 Fluorometer (Invitrogen, Carlsbad, CA). Final libraries were checked with both Qubit 2.0 Fluorometer (Invitrogen, Carlsbad, CA) and Agilent Bioanalyzer DNA assay (Agilent technologies, Santa Clara, CA). Libraries were then prepared for sequencing and sequenced on paired-end 150 bp mode on NovaSeq6000 (Illumina, San Diego, CA).

Data processing |
To analyse the raw sequences obtained and estimate methylation levels per chromosome and compare them across treatment between controls and seeds from plants primed by Ina, BaBa and MeJa, we used the pipeline MethPipe (Song et al.,2013) Trim Galore (https://www.bioinformatics.babraham.ac.uk/projects/trim_galore/) was used for adapter trimming as well as quality control, with some added functionality to remove biased methylation positions. Abismal (de Sena Brandine et al., 2021) was used to construct the methylome and map bisulfite treated short reads on the tomato plant genome.
